How much does a Electronics Engineer make?

The average salary for a Electronics Engineer is $123,688 per year in the US.

Electronics engineers enjoy a rewarding career, both intellectually and financially. The average yearly salary for an electronics engineer stands at $123,688, reflecting the high demand for their skills in today’s technology-driven world.


Starting salaries begin at around $58,000, allowing newcomers to enter the field with a solid foundation. As they gain experience, earnings increase significantly. For example, four years into their careers, electronics engineers can expect an average salary of about $97,727. A few years later, salaries can reach around $141,455. With further experience and specialization, some professionals earn upwards of $211,000.


This distribution of salaries illustrates a clear path for growth. Higher-level positions become available as engineers develop their skills, take on more responsibilities, and gain expertise. Overall, this profession offers lucrative opportunities and a clear trajectory for upward mobility.

What are the highest paying cities for a Electronics Engineer?

Electronics Engineers can find some of the highest salaries in cities like Chicago, IL, where the average salary reaches $167,195. Seattle, WA, and San Diego, CA follow closely with average salaries of $159,542 and $158,859, respectively. Other notable cities include San Jose, CA, and Austin, TX, where salaries also remain competitive, making these locations attractive for job seekers in the field.

How to earn more as a Electronics Engineer?

As an Electronics Engineer, you have the chance to boost your earnings significantly. Consider these important factors that can help you increase your income:

  • Advanced Education: Pursuing higher education, such as a master's degree or professional certifications, can open doors to higher-paying positions.
  • Specialization: Focusing on a niche area, like embedded systems or wireless communications, can make you more valuable to employers.
  • Experience: Gaining hands-on experience through internships or entry-level jobs helps you build a strong resume that attracts better offers.
  • Networking: Building professional connections can lead to job opportunities that may not be advertised. Attend industry events and join professional organizations.
  • Location: Some regions or cities offer higher salaries due to demand for Electronics Engineers. Relocating to these areas can significantly increase your earning potential.
